Why Having A Skate Park Near By Is A Game Changer For Skaters

Skateboarding is not just a sport, it’s a lifestyle. It’s a way to express creativity, conquer fears, and build a community. For skateboarders, finding a skate park nearby can completely change the game. Having a skate park within easy reach can mean the difference between skating occasionally for fun and fully immersing yourself in the skateboarding world.

When a skate park is nearby, skaters have a convenient place to practice their skills and push their limits. No longer do they have to search for makeshift spots or worry about getting kicked out by security. A skate park provides a safe and designated area for skaters to hone their craft without any interruptions or restrictions. This not only allows skaters to progress faster but also helps them build confidence in their abilities.

Another advantage of having a skate park nearby is the sense of community it fosters. Skateboarding is often a solo activity, but having a skate park as a gathering place brings skaters together. They can share tips, tricks, and experiences, and push each other to try new things. Friendships are formed, bonds are strengthened, and the skate park becomes a hub for like-minded individuals to connect and support each other. Whether it’s cheering each other on during a challenging trick or commiserating after a tough fall, the camaraderie at a skate park is unmatched.

Additionally, a skate park near by can be a positive influence on the local community. Instead of seeing skateboarders as a nuisance or a problem, residents may come to appreciate the talent and dedication that skaters bring to their neighborhood. Skate parks can also serve as a platform for events, competitions, and fundraisers, bringing people from all walks of life together to celebrate the sport. This not only promotes a sense of unity and inclusivity but also highlights the skills and creativity of the skaters themselves.

From a physical health perspective, having a skate park nearby encourages skaters to stay active and fit. Skateboarding is a full-body workout that improves balance, coordination, and cardiovascular endurance. It challenges both the mind and body, promoting mental focus and agility. With a skate park just around the corner, skaters are more likely to engage in regular physical activity and reap the numerous health benefits that come with it.

Moreover, a skate park near by can also have a positive impact on mental well-being. Skateboarding is a form of self-expression and stress relief for many individuals. It allows skaters to escape the pressures of everyday life, release pent-up energy, and channel their emotions into something constructive. The freedom and creativity inherent in skateboarding can be incredibly therapeutic, boosting mood and self-confidence. Having a skate park nearby provides a sanctuary for skaters to unwind, recharge, and rejuvenate their spirits.
